Solid carbide end mills are another classification of tools that excel in effectiveness and reducing precision. These end mills are made from a solitary piece of carbide, supplying remarkable hardness and put on resistance compared to layered tools. Solid carbide end mills are extensively used in sectors needing high precision and performance, such as aerospace and mold-making.

HSS end mills, although not as durable as carbide end mills, still have their area in the machining world. They are cost-efficient and offer satisfying performance in less demanding applications. The option in between HSS and carbide eventually relies on the particular needs of the task available. For roughing operations or situations where device substitute expenses require to be minimized, HSS end mills can be a feasible selection.

The spot face drill bit is one more specialized device used in machining. Spot dealing with is a procedure to develop a flat, smooth surface, commonly around a drilled hole, to make sure correct seats of fasteners or various other elements. Carbide spot drills are crucial for initiating this process with high precision. These drills produce a little impression or 'spot' that guides the larger cutting tool, making sure precise placement and positioning. Spot drill bits may come in various configurations, yet their primary function stays to supply a specific beginning point for boring procedures, boosting the total precision and top quality of the ended up item.
